We bought our Wii Fit on Saturday and are loving it so far. I think Stephen and I are like most people. We want to exercise, we mean to exercise, sometimes we even start a routine, but we always fall out of the routine over time. I think the Wii Fit is a great way to motivate people to get going. I don't think it is really for those hard-core exercisers unless they just want something fun or quick to do. Anyway, I'm really enjoying it. It keeps track of your BMI and weight. It also keeps record of how well you do in all of the activities so you can see if you have improved and you can try and beat other people that have profiles on your game. The areas are yoga, strength training, aerobics, and balance.
